Hu Chao

Hu Chao is a Guangzhou-based art historian and curator. An associate research professor at Guangzhou Academy of Fine Arts, his research and curatorial practice examine the arts of China, Southeast Asia, and developing nations to contextualise Global South discourses. He is the author of Constructing National Identity: National Museums and Galleries in Singapore (in Chinese).
